Challenges in Metal Detection for Various Food Products
The variety of food products, from liquids to solids, presents different hurdles for metal detectors. Raw, processed, and semi-processed foods each have their own complexities. Liquid products, like soups and sauces, often pose a challenge due to the potential for metal particles to be suspended or hidden within the liquid medium. Solid foods, such as fruits and vegetables, can be tricky to screen because of their irregular shapes and textures, which can impact the sensitivity of the detection system.
Processed foods, including meat and dairy products, present a different set of issues, such as the presence of fillings, additives, and varying moisture content, which can affect the conductivity and hence the detection of metal contaminants.

Impact of Metal Contamination on Consumer Health
Metal contamination can manifest in various forms, each with its own health implications. Sharp metal fragments, for instance, pose a significant risk of physical injury. Contamination with heavy metals like lead or cadmium can cause severe health problems, including organ damage and developmental issues in children. Ingestion of metallic objects, regardless of size, can also lead to blockages in the digestive tract.
The specific health risks vary depending on the type and quantity of the metal, emphasizing the importance of thorough and consistent metal detection.

Designing a Metal Detection System for Optimal Hygiene
Designing a metal detection system for optimal hygiene requires a holistic perspective that considers both the technical aspects of the system and the surrounding environment. The placement of the detection system should be strategic, ensuring complete coverage of the product flow and minimizing the risk of contamination. Regular maintenance schedules should be implemented to ensure that the system remains in top working order and to prevent potential malfunctions.
The system’s design should be simple and easy to clean, minimizing the accumulation of food particles or debris that can harbor bacteria. The choice of materials used in the construction of the detection system should be non-reactive and easily sanitized. For example, stainless steel is a common and effective material for construction due to its durability, non-reactivity, and ease of cleaning.
By carefully considering these factors, the food processor can maximize the hygiene and safety of their metal detection system.

System Architecture for Conveyor Belt Integration
A well-designed system architecture for integrating a metal detector with a conveyor belt ensures seamless operation. The architecture must consider the speed and capacity of the conveyor belt, the sensitivity and detection range of the metal detector, and the required response time for product rejection. This design allows for continuous monitoring and real-time product quality assurance.
Component | Description |
---|---|
Conveyor Belt | Transports food products along the processing line. |
Metal Detector | Detects metal contaminants in the products. |
Signal Processing Unit | Processes signals from the metal detector, triggering appropriate responses. |
Rejection System | Removes contaminated products from the conveyor belt. |
Control System | Monitors the entire process and controls the different components. |
